How to Choose a Mountable Soap Dispenser for Commercial Bathrooms

To choose the right mountable soap dispenser for a commercial bathroom, I recommend evaluating seven factors together: mounting method, capacity, refill system, material, hygiene, maintenance, and supplier support. A dispenser that looks suitable in a catalog may not work well if it cannot fit the wall, soap formulation, cleaning routine, or traffic level of the facility. I start by matching the dispenser to the installation environment, then confirm capacity, durability, serviceability, and purchasing requirements with the supplier.

Understand the Basic Concept

A mountable soap dispenser is a dispenser designed to be fixed to a wall, partition, vanity side, or another stable surface instead of standing freely on a countertop. The product normally combines a reservoir, pump or dispensing mechanism, cover, mounting hardware, and a refill access method. Depending on the model, it may dispense liquid soap, foam soap, or another compatible hand-cleaning formulation.

The main purpose is to keep soap available at a predictable position while reducing countertop clutter and making the wash area easier to organize. However, the actual result depends on correct installation, suitable soap viscosity, proper cleaning, and regular replenishment. For this reason, I evaluate the complete operating system rather than looking only at appearance.

Compare the Main Types and Materials

Surface-Mounted Dispensers

Surface-mounted units are fixed directly onto a wall or partition. They are often suitable for renovation projects because they generally require less wall modification than recessed products. Before approval, I check the wall material, mounting surface thickness, fixing method, and clearance around the dispenser.

Recessed or Semi-Recessed Dispensers

Recessed designs sit partly or fully inside the wall and can create a streamlined appearance. They may be appropriate for new construction or major renovation, but they require accurate coordination between the dispenser dimensions and the wall cavity. I recommend confirming the cutout drawing before the wall finish is completed.

Single and Multiple Dispenser Configurations

A single unit may be enough for a small washroom or a location with one soap formulation. Multiple units can be considered when the facility needs separate products, higher availability, or a coordinated hygiene station. The decision should account for wall width, user flow, cleaning access, and the number of washbasins.

Material Choices

Common material options include ABS, other engineering plastics, stainless steel, and combinations of metal and plastic components. Plastic may support a lighter and more cost-sensitive design, while stainless steel can suit projects that prioritize a metal appearance or a more substantial enclosure. I ask for the exact material grade, surface finish, component structure, and cleaning guidance instead of relying on general terms such as “durable” or “premium.”

Use the Application to Set the Specifications

Capacity is one of the first practical specifications to compare. For example, I may compare a 500 ml unit for a compact or lower-traffic location with a 1,000 ml unit for a busier washroom, but the final choice should be based on observed consumption and refill routines. A larger reservoir is not automatically better if staff cannot access it easily or if the soap may remain unused for long periods.

Next, confirm the dispensing mechanism. Liquid soap pumps and foam soap pumps are not always interchangeable because the formulation and air-mixing requirements can differ. I request compatibility information for the specific soap product, including viscosity guidance when available, and I avoid assuming that every dispenser can handle sanitizer or concentrated formulations.

Mounting dimensions also need careful review. I check the overall height, width, depth, wall clearance, and the fixing pattern before approving a product; for example, a project may require approximately 30–50 mm of clear working space around the unit for opening, cleaning, or refilling. These figures are planning references rather than universal requirements, so the supplier’s technical drawing should control the final installation.

Follow a Practical Selection Framework

Step 1: Identify the Site Conditions

I first record the number of washbasins, expected user volume, wall type, available mounting area, and cleaning access. I also check whether the installation is new construction, renovation, or a replacement project. This prevents a visually attractive dispenser from being selected without confirming whether it can be securely installed.

Step 2: Define the Refill Routine

I then ask who will refill the dispenser, how frequently the facility team checks it, and whether the operator prefers top filling, front access, removable containers, or replaceable cartridges. A refill method should be simple enough for the maintenance team and secure enough to reduce accidental opening. Clear level visibility can also help staff identify when service is needed.

Step 3: Match the Product to the Soap

The dispenser should be evaluated with the intended formulation, not only with water or a generic sample. I confirm whether the product is designed for liquid soap, foam soap, lotion-like products, or sanitizer, and I ask how the pump should be cleaned if the formulation changes. If the soap is unusually thick or contains particles, I request a compatibility review before placing a bulk order.

Step 4: Review Hygiene and Maintenance

I look for smooth external surfaces, limited dirt-collecting gaps, accessible refill points, and a design that allows staff to wipe the housing without difficulty. Touchless operation may be relevant in some projects, while manual operation can be preferred where simplicity, budget, or serviceability is the priority. Neither operating method should be selected without considering power requirements, user expectations, and maintenance procedures.

Step 5: Validate the Installation

Before procurement, I compare the technical drawing with the wall layout, mirror, faucet, backsplash, grab rail, and other bathroom accessories. I confirm whether the package includes mounting hardware or whether the installer must source fixings for the local wall substrate. If the project has strict visual requirements, I also review finish samples and the position of logos or labels.

Evaluate Cost, MOQ, and Lead Time Correctly

The purchase price is only one part of the total cost. I also consider mounting accessories, replacement pumps or containers, packaging, shipping volume, installation labor, cleaning time, and the cost of changing a product that does not fit the site. A lower unit price may be less attractive if the dispenser requires frequent service or creates installation delays.

For a commercial order, I ask the supplier to quote the exact model, material, finish, capacity, dispensing type, packaging, and quantity. MOQ and lead time can change according to stock status, customization, order volume, and destination, so I request written confirmation for the specific project rather than relying on a general catalog statement. If the schedule is important, I also ask about sample approval, production milestones, inspection arrangements, and shipment documentation.

Supplier Evaluation Checklist

When I compare suppliers, I review more than product photographs. I check whether the supplier can provide dimensional drawings, material descriptions, installation instructions, refill guidance, spare-part information, and clear communication about customization. These documents help the buyer evaluate technical fit and reduce avoidable misunderstandings during installation.

  • Can the supplier provide a product sample or pre-production sample?
  • Are the capacity, dimensions, finish, and dispensing method clearly specified?
  • Is the pump suitable for the soap formulation used by the project?
  • Are replacement parts and maintenance instructions available?
  • Can the supplier explain MOQ, packaging, production timing, and inspection options?
  • Can the supplier coordinate the dispenser with other bathroom accessories?

Common Mistakes to Avoid

One common mistake is choosing by appearance without checking the mounting surface and refill access. Another is comparing capacities without considering soap consumption, cleaning schedules, and the number of users. I also advise buyers not to assume that stainless steel, plastic, manual, or touchless construction is automatically the best option; suitability depends on the project’s operating conditions.

Buyers should also avoid approving a bulk order before checking a sample or technical drawing. A small difference in depth, fixing position, cover access, or pump performance can affect installation and daily maintenance. Where the soap formulation is not standard, testing or supplier confirmation is especially important.
